(6) Goodwill and Other Intangible Assets

The majority of the Company’s identified intangibles are in the form of amortizable core deposit premium.  A small portion of the fully amortized identified intangibles represent identified intangibles in the acquisition of the rights to the insurance agency contracts of InsCorp, Inc., acquired in 2008. Amortization expense of intangible assets for the years ended December 31, 2016, 2015 and 2014, was $128,000,  $644,000 and $2,389,000, respectively. Estimated amortization expense for each of the five succeeding fiscal years, and thereafter, is as follows:
